1. History of the Ice House Comedy Club
The Ice House Comedy Club is a cornerstone of the comedy scene in Los Angeles and has a legacy that spans over six decades. Originally established as a coffee house, the venue transitioned into a comedy club in the 1970s, quickly gaining recognition for its intimate setting and diverse lineup of performers. The club was one of the first to showcase stand-up comedy in a casual environment, making it accessible to a broader audience.
Throughout its history, the Ice House has played host to many famous comedians, including Robin Williams, George Carlin, and Ellen DeGeneres. This rich legacy has solidified its reputation as a launching pad for many successful careers in comedy, fostering a creative environment where comedians can hone their craft.
Key Milestones in the Ice House's History
- 1960: Ice House opens as a coffee house.
- 1970s: Transition to a comedy club.
- 1980s: Hosts famous comedians and gains national recognition.
- 1990s: Expands its reach with successful open mic nights.
- 2000s: Continues to attract top talent and maintain relevance.
2. The Venue: Atmosphere and Features
The Ice House Comedy Club boasts a cozy and inviting atmosphere, designed to enhance the comedy experience. The venue features a main stage that allows for an up-close and personal connection between performers and the audience, creating an engaging environment for laughter and entertainment.
In addition to the main stage, the club includes a bar and lounge area where guests can enjoy food and drinks before or after the show. The decor is a blend of classic charm and modern touches, making it a perfect spot for a night out. The Ice House is also equipped with state-of-the-art sound and lighting systems, ensuring that every performance is of the highest quality.
Key Features of the Ice House
- Intimate seating arrangement for a personal experience.
- High-quality sound and lighting for optimal performances.
- Bar and lounge area for food and drinks.
- Regular open mic nights and themed events.

5. Ticketing and Reservations
For those interested in attending a show at the Ice House, purchasing tickets is straightforward. Tickets can be bought online through the official Ice House website or at the box office on the day of the event. It is advisable to purchase tickets in advance, especially for popular shows, as they tend to sell out quickly.
Ticket Pricing
Ticket prices vary depending on the event and performer. On average, tickets range from $15 to $25, with special events potentially costing more. Group discounts and package deals are often available, making it an affordable option for an entertaining night out.
